Dreamworld
Many single-family homes, townhouses and condos to choose from
Most of Dreamworld’s residents are renters—about 65%—and live in the apartment complexes scattered throughout the neighborhood. Single-family homes are primarily concentrated in the neighborhood’s northeast corner, where lots are roomy and mature trees form canopies of shade on streets and front lawns. Most homes are ranch-style and built between 1950 and 1990, though there are some contemporary builds from the early 2000s, too. Prices range from $250,000 to $385,000, with some fixer-upper options ranging from $170,000 to $225,000. Placid Woods, a newer subdivision closer to the neighborhood’s west side, offers three- and four-bedroom contemporary homes built in 2000 and 2001. Prices range from $300,000 to $335,000. Two- and three-bedroom townhouses are also available, priced between $260,000 and almost $300,000, and condos range from $160,000 for two bedrooms to $200,000 for three bedrooms. Seminole County Public Schools is widely recognized as a Premier National School District and has received an A rating from the Florida Department of Education for 2022-2023. Seminole High School is part of the district and highly rated, earning an A on Niche. It serves about 4,000 students and offers magnet curriculums focused on several fields, including aviation and health. Younger students often attend the B-minus-rated Wicklow Elementary School and the B-rated Millennium Middle School. McKibbin Park is located on West 25th Street and features a covered playground, which helps kids stay out of the sun while they play, picnic tables and plenty of green space. The nearby Sanford RiverWalk’s multi-use trails span five miles and include shaded swinging benches by the shoreline. The RiverWalk also connects to a 26-mile loop around the lake and the Florida Coast-to-Coast trail, providing even more opportunities for people to explore the state.Residents run errands at The Seminole Centre
Residents are close to Bravo Supermarkets on Highway 17, which is convenient for picking up groceries. A little farther south on Highway 17 is The Seminole Centre, a shopping center that offers Walmart, Aldi and some fast-food restaurants. Most residents head into downtown Sanford to dine out. Hollerbach's is a popular destination, loved for its authentic German dishes and beer selection.Sanford has many monthly and annual events
Residents have easy access to events in downtown Sanford, including the monthly Alive After 5, which fills East First Street with live music, and the Sanford Food Truck Fiesta, which takes place on the second Sunday of the month and offers over 30 food trucks. Annual events include the St. Johns River Festival of the Arts, which celebrates local artisans, and Star Spangled Sanford, the city’s 4th of July celebration at Lake Monroe.Highways and airport get residents where they need to go
Highways 417 and 17 run along the neighborhood’s boundaries and lead to downtown Orlando, about 25 miles south. Public transportation is limited, but the LYNX bus line has some stops along Highway 17. For longer trips, the Orlando Sanford International Airport is about 5 miles east and offers flights nationwide. For Beth Nicholas, a Sanford resident since 1972, having easy access to the Sanford airport is a huge perk. “Orlando International Airport can be such a hassle. Orlando Sanford is much easier to get in and out of,” she says.
